Frosty
Visits Florida
By Ariel D. Smith
One
day in winter, a girl named Annie built a snowman. She looked all through the house to find the perfect hat, but
every hat she found just wasn't right.
Then she looked in Grandpop's old trunk in the attic and found an
ancient top hat. It was perfect! Once she put it on her snowman she thought
she saw his arm move. "I must be seeing
things," she said. Suddenly, the
snowman started to dance around. He
told her his name was Frosty.
She had many adventures with Frosty, but this
one was the best. Once in the middle of
winter, Annie told Frosty she was going to visit her Grandparents in Florida. She would stay at Disney World. Frosty knew he would terribly miss her, so
he started to think of a plan. He would
put his clothes on with dry ice inside.
It might make him look fat, but it was his only chance. So he hopped on the plane to Florida with
her. Once they got to the Magic
Kingdom, they started walking around and going on rides. (Frosty bought tons of ice cream.) On their way to a show, a man walked up to
Frosty and said, "Hey, you're on in 15 minutes. Get your costume on!"
Frosty tried to explain, but the man wouldn't listen. Frosty was worried that he might melt on
stage. Once he was dressed in his
Mickey costume, the man came back and said to go out on stage. Once frosty got out he realized he had
nothing to worry about because it turned out to be a Disney on ice show, and
Frosty was a natural born skater. The
rest of the vacation was fun. This is
only one of the great adventures Frosty and Annie had over the next few
years.
